Overview
FZT957QTC from Diodes Incorporated is a 300V PNP high-voltage transistor in SOT223 package, designed for high-voltage switching and linear regulation. It delivers -1A continuous collector current, -300V VCEO, and VCE(sat) < -240mV @ -1A, enabling robust operation in off-line power supplies and industrial control circuits.

Technical Context
This PNP bipolar junction transistor operates with a minimum BVCEO of -300V and supports peak pulse current up to -2A. Its hFE remains ≥90 at -1A and ≥10 at -2A, ensuring stable gain across load range. The device is rated for operation from -55°C to +150°C with JEDEC Class 3A HBM ESD rating (4kV).
Thermal resistance is specified as RθJA = 42°C/W on 52mm×52mm 2oz copper, and RθJL = 8.8°C/W to lead-critical for heatsinkless designs requiring direct lead soldering. Switching times are ton = 108ns and toff = 2.5μs under -100V VCC, -500mA IC, and ±50mA base drive.

Pinout & Package
Package: SOT223 (Type DN), surface-mount, 4-pin configuration with exposed collector tab (pin 3) for thermal conduction. Molded green compound, RoHS-compliant, matte tin-plated leads.
| Pin/Terminal | Circuit Role | Design Meaning |
|---|---|---|
| Pin 1 (Emitter) | E | Current source terminal; connected to positive rail in high-side switch configurations. |
| Pin 2 (Base) | B | Control input; requires ~300mA drive for full saturation at -1A IC. |
| Pin 3 (Collector) | C | Main current sink path; electrically and thermally tied to exposed metal tab for PCB heat spreading. |
| Pin 4 (Collector Tab) | C (common with Pin 3) | Primary thermal interface; must be soldered to ≥52mm² 2oz copper pour for rated power dissipation. |

FAQ
What is the maximum safe operating voltage for FZT957QTC in continuous DC mode?
The absolute maximum collector-emitter voltage (VCEO) is -300V at TA = +25°C. Derating is required above 25°C: voltage rating decreases linearly by 0.25V/°C above 25°C per the datasheet's safe operating area curve. At 100°C ambient, the practical limit is approximately -281V for DC operation with adequate heatsinking.
Can FZT957QTC be used as a direct replacement for FZT957TA or FZT957TC?
Yes-FZT957QTC shares identical electrical specifications, SOT223 (Type DN) package, and marking code (FZT957) with FZT957TA and FZT957TC. The "Q" suffix denotes qualification to AEC-Q101, but all three variants are pin- and electrically compatible. Reel size and tape width differ (13-inch reel, 12mm tape, 4,000 units), but no design changes are needed.
How should the exposed collector tab be connected on the PCB for optimal thermal performance?
The exposed collector tab (Pin 3 and Pin 4) must be soldered to a minimum 52mm × 52mm area of 2oz copper on the PCB to achieve the rated RθJA = 42°C/W. Thermal vias under the tab are recommended, and the copper pour must remain unbroken and directly connected to the collector net-no isolation gaps or thermal relief spokes.
